AUT 7 - Automotive Electrical Systems Lab

Course Description: In this course students will develop and demonstrate the hands-on skills needed to repair automotive electrical/electronic systems. Topics include verification, diagnosis and repair of vehicle charging and starting systems, lighting systems, and supplemental restraint systems.

Objectives

Upon successful completion of this course, the student should be able to:

  1. Diagnose and repair, to industry standards, vehicle systems related to batteries.
  2. Diagnose and repair vehicle multiplex communication networks.
  3. Diagnose and repair vehicle lighting and signaling systems.
  4. Diagnose and repair vehicle charging systems.
  5. Diagnose and repair vehicle starting systems.
  6. Diagnose and repair passive restraint and supplemental restraint systems.

Examples of Assignments

Reading Assignments

  1. Read safety precautions for air bag removal then demonstrate the procedure to remove an air bag.
  2. Read lab assigned instructions on safe battery handling. Be prepared to replace an automobile battery in class.

Writing Assignments

  1. Measure voltage drops in a charging or starting system. Complete a written report on the findings and any recommendations.
  2. Conclude an air bag system diagnosis. Communicate the findings for customer review on a repair order.
